Q: Is 618,706 a Prime Number?

 A: No, 618,706 is not a prime number.

Why is 618,706 not a prime number?

A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.

The number 618706 can be evenly divided by 1 2 11 22 28,123 56,246 309,353 and 618,706, with no remainder.

Since 618,706 cannot be divided by just 1 and 618,706, it is not a prime number.
